Vehicle hire firm benefits from Bibby funding arrangement

Vehicle hire firm Hexagon Leasing is to roll out a new vehicle sales division following a £600,000 purchase funding agreement from Bibby Financial Services.

Hexagon Leasing operates an 800-strong fleet of HGVs, vans and cars, offering vehicles on a contract hire or rental basis to businesses across the UK. Using a £600,000 purchase funding facility – structured by the Bibby Financial Services West Midlands team – the business is set to launch a new division offering vehicle sales.

Vehicles will be purchased by Derby-based Hexagon Leasing, refurbished and sold on to existing customers, dealerships and the private market. BFS has agreed to advance an amount for the business to purchase a fleet of vehicles, without stipulating an invoice finance facility to cover the sale of vehicles to Hexagon’s customers.

Ben Smith, head of Bibby Financial Services’ West Midlands Business Centre claimed the deal demonstrated his team’s “agility and innovation”. He said: “Our team has worked closely with the team at Hexagon to understand their ambitions and appetite for growth. It would be difficult to imagine another provider who could offer similar levels of service and flexibility.

“This facility is solely based on the balance sheet of the business and our confidence in the team, and it demonstrates our expertise when it comes to managing risk effectively to support business growth.”

Throughout the rest of Q1, Hexagon Leasing plans to refurbish and sell in excess of 140 vehicles, while maintaining its contract hire stock levels. The new venture is projected to increase the company’s annual profits by more than 30% to £750,000 in 2015.

Smith added: “While Bibby Financial Services is traditionally known as an invoice finance provider, we structure a range of transactions for stock purchase, mergers and acquisitions, turnaround and refinancing, so we can help businesses, whatever their requirements.”
